Porsche Pays Homage to Legendary 911 Designer with Limited-Edition GT3
Porsche has unveiled a special-edition GT3 paying homage to Ferdinand Alexander, the legendary designer who penned the 911.
Image: Porsche
Commemorating Ferdinand Alexander “Butzi” Porsche, the visionary designer who penned the 911, Porsche has unveiled a new limited-edition 911 GT3, the 90 F.A. A nod to the late designer, who would have celebrated his 9oth birthday in December 2025, only 90 examples will be made. Noteworthy, one of the 90 units has already been purchased by Ferdinand Alexander’s son, Mark.
Developed by Porsche’s Sonderwunsch division, the commemorative model’s exterior and interior were inspired by F.A. Porsche’s own G-Series 911, which he drove in the 1980s. The 911 GT3 F.A.’s bodywork is finished in model-specific Green metallic paint inspired by F.A’s Oak Green metallic 911. Gold-coloured decals are also present. The limited-run model is fitted with a set of Sport Classic wheels, replete with the Stuttgart marque’s 1963 crest on the central-locking wheel caps.
The cabin features Truffle Brown Club leather upholstery and F.A. Grid-Weave fabric for the seat inserts, glove box, and luggage compartment mat. The latter trim draws inspiration from the pattern of F.A’s favourite jacket, and is made up of five colours: Black, Green, Truffle Brown, Cream, and Bordeaux Red. The interior further receives a specialised plaque with F.A. Porsche’s signature engraved on the open-pore walnut gear knob. Another gold-plated plaque with the 911’s silhouette and ‘One of 90’ can be found on the dashboard.
Based on the 911 GT3 Touring, the anniversary model is powered by a 4.0-litre flat-six, endowed with 375 kW and 450 N.m of torque. The naturally aspirated unit can be had with the choice of two transmission options: six-speed manual and seven-speed dual-clutch (PDK). The manual- and PDK-equipped variants complete the 0-100 km/h sprint in 3.9 and 3.4 seconds, respectively, before topping out at 311 and 313 km/h, respectively.
The 911 GT3 90 F.A. will be available to order from April 2026, and will include an exclusive edition of the Porsche Design Chronograph 1 watch and a special weekender bag. The Porsche Junior, a sports sled originally designed by F.A. Porsche, is also available. Only 90 units of the carbon-fibre sled in matching spec will be made.
